Provincial Council Elections 2023

The Provincial Council is responsible for governing the Party and overseeing the activities of the district associations, committees, and working groups within our organization. Comprised of nine voting members, the Council includes the President, Secretary-Treasurer, Leader, and six Members-at-Large. As we approach the upcoming Provincial Council Elections, six positions on the Council are set to become vacant. 

Adina Nault (Charlottetown) and Darlene Doiron (Stratford) remain as Members-at-Large until
2024 and Peter Bevan-Baker remains on Council as Leader.

Additionally, the Provincial Council includes two ex-officio positions, which are non-voting roles: the Deputy Leader and the Official Agent. Currently, Lynne Lund holds the position of Deputy Leader, and Derek Donohoe serves as the Official Agent.

In line with our commitment to diversity and inclusivity, the Green Party of PEI aims to ensure that the composition of the Provincial Council reflects the province's diverse demographics, including gender, ethnicity, culture, age, region, and language.
